Barack Obama Diet

Barack Obama’s diet? Barack Obama’s diet is not perfect, but he eats right, even when he and his wife, Michelle, 44, dine at Topolobampo, their favorite Mexican restaurant back home in Chicago.
“There isn’t melted cheese and sour cream over everything,” says chef Rick Bayless, who is a contender to become the Obamas‘ chef at the White House. “We begin with fresh, nonprocessed ingredients, and the dish is naturally better and completely satisfying. What’s great about the Obamas is that they try everything.” One of their favorites? The fresh sweet corn.
Barack Obama’s diet Obama likes snacks – “nuts, trail mix, granola bars,” says one political insider. But like everyone else, Obama has been known to occasionally indulge in cheese steaks, fried chicken and pizza. Luckily, he burns lots of calories because he is so active.
